Transaction 58d186f75b6b4ea03c84dbffe607acf8ad88287abf5952e909fb3bfd177f86fd
1 Input
1 Output
-
58d186f75b6b4ea03c84dbffe607acf8ad88287abf5952e909fb3bfd177f86fd:0
- value
- 394898
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a2eb13c9f6814c98994cc27ea5b4594764c2f1b
- address
- bc1qrghtz0yldq2vnzv5esn75k69j3myctcmqwtn5p